Bowhunting Turkeys

Bowhunting them is tough! And expensive.
Last year:
1 miss, arrow not recovered -$30
1 hit, complete pass through arrow not recovered -$30
Finishing shot on above bird, shaft snapped (saved broadhead and Lumenok) -$7
So, final talley was one bird = $67.
Experience = priceless
